Find the Best Restaurants Around Sternes, Crete, Greece

Browse Restaurants, Read Reviews, Look at Photos and Menus in Sternes, Crete, Greece on Foodporn Today. Not interested in going somewhere to eat? Check out some of our recipes instead!

Loutraki Restaurant and Seaside Bar

Niolos

To Tylixto Grill House

To Ftoxiko

Loading...
Scroll to Top